Lady Dimitrescu is shorter in Resident Evil Village: The Mercenaries, why?

Before it w launched to the market, the fury for Lady Dimitrescu had already spread throughout the network. This resident villain Evil Village h become one of the most popular characters in the entire saga, so many will be glad of to be able to control it in The Mercenaries mode, that can be enjoyed part of the DLC that also Includes Shadows of Rose expansion. However, the gigantic stature of the vampire h had to be reduced, explained by director Kenton Hiroshima in an interview with polygon.

The control, a priority for Cap com

Resident The height of Lady Dimitrescu brought us a lot of headaches during development, but in the end we could introduce it with the gigantic stature of it, higher than any of the other characters, he recalled. Facing The Mercenaries, It w necessary for the player to control the character eily , so to make it possible we had to adjust the height of it below the 9 feet. With that height, the player avoids the roofs hard.

In the Cap com video game, Lady Dimitrescu meured almost 10 feet, which translates into about 2.6 meters . Therefore, she will be somewhat lower than in the main game, although she will continue to maintain the imposing figure of her and all the charism of her intact.

Resident Evil Village will close the history of the Winters family with the Shadows of Rose expansion, starring Ethan's daughter. The expansion of the Winters and the Gold edition of the video game will go on sale on October 28 on PS4, PS5, Xbox One, Xbox Series X, Xbox Series S and PC. That same day the cloud edition of the game for Nintendo Switch will also be marketed, although the expansion and the rest of extra content will not be available in the hybrid until December.
